LegalShield Plan Costs 2025
Navigating LegalShield’s plan costs for 2025 can feel somewhat complex, but understanding available options is crucial. Typically, LegalShield offers several tiers, each with different levels of coverage and related costs. The most basic plan, designed for single people, will likely range from approximately $45 per month, including access to a panel of attorney professionals for basic consultations and document review. For households, family package often proves more economical, typically costing between $55 to $65 per month, assisting multiple household residents. Alongside the standard plans, certain plans may include supplemental benefits, such as protection against identity theft or lower pricing on specialized legal services. It's always confirm current details on the LegalShield's official website or speak with a representative for the most precise price breakdown.
